Output def68dc5ea02cd2f8c5b87ee6a5b6e5fac960fd253b4a8c6f86cdb2d84f205d7:0

value
1773617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db23890b66578ae041c4bd12b400189ce104cf00 OP_EQUAL
address
3MfiUbKuQMy98NR9AEXGtM1ZJGjYrDZwj3
transaction
def68dc5ea02cd2f8c5b87ee6a5b6e5fac960fd253b4a8c6f86cdb2d84f205d7
confirmations
102305
spent
true